Stir-Fried Pork in Garlic Sauce

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ons peanut or vegetable oil
  • 2 tablespoons garlic, peeled and chopped
  • 2 dried chiles
  • 1 1/2 pounds boneless pork, preferably from the shoulder (Boston butt or picnic), sliced thinly and dried
  • 1 bunch scallions, cut into 2-inch lengths, white and green parts separated
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• Cooked white rice

Instructions

  1. Put oil in a large nonstick skillet or wok, and turn heat to high; a minute later add garlic and chiles; cook, stirring occasionally, until garlic begins to color.
  2. Add pork and cook, stirring once or twice, until it begins to brown, about 2 minutes.
  3. Add white parts of scallions, and stir; cook another minute, stirring occasionally.
  4. Stir in green parts of scallions; cook for 30 seconds, then turn off heat and add soy sauce.
  5. Serve immediately with rice.
